Former Lipscomb University player, Mickey has over 20 years of coaching experience and is currently the manager of the Twitty City Hallmark 19 and over, Team 2001 Stan Musial State Champs. Mickey led his 17-year-old Twitty City Hallmark team to NABF World Series title in 1998. Former players have gone on to college and minor league baseball.

Orlando is a former minor league player and coach with the St. Louis Cardinals. He has been teaching lessons at Hit After Hit since 1993. Several of his students have gone on to play college baseball. Orlando coached his 16-year-old team to the CABA World Series in 1999 and took his 17-year-old team to the same tournament in 2000. His 18-year-old team was the CABA World Series runner up in 2001.

Tim's main focus has been teaching the sound fundamentals of baseball, disciplined work ethics and respect for one's self and other players. Tim graduated from Lipscomb University in 1982 where he played under coach Ken Dugan. Married 26 years to Kathi, they have 2 children - Kristen an RN at Vanderbilt University and Steven played at Vanderbilt University and is now in the Twin's organization.

Lem was drafted in 1984 by the Baltimore Orioles as a catcher and first baseman. In 1986, the Boston Red Sox drafted Lem out of Columbia State Community College. He played in the Red Sox, Blue Jays and Mariners organizations and was a 2-time minor league all-star. Lem also coached with the Mariners organization for 2 years. He started giving lessons in 1986 and opened Hit After Hit in November of 1993.



Hit after Hit offers private lessons for students of all age and ability levels. All of our lessons are taught on a one on one basis by our knowledgeable and experienced instructors. All lessons are 30 minutes long and students may come on a regularly scheduled basis. Students are taught the mechanics of hitting, pitching or catching. Parents are encouraged to watch and listen. We ask that all questions and comments be held until the end of the lesson, at which time the instructor will be happy to answer all questions.
